    Fabric Requirements
    3/4 yd light blue
    1 1/4 yd white
    1/2 yd dark blue
    1/2 yd medium blue*
    2 yds backing
    *this includes enough for binding the quilt with the medium color fabric
    Cutting Instructions
    light blue - cut 3 - 7.5 inch strips into 13 - 7.5 inch squares
    white - 3 - 7.5 inch strips into 13 - 7.5 inch squares
    6 - 2.5 inch strips into 96- 2.5 inch squares
    medium blue - 2 - 2.5 inch strips into 24 2.5 inch squares
    dark blue - 6 - 2.5 inch strips into 96 2.5 inch squares
    binding - 5 - 2.5 inch strips
    Make 25 Hourglass blocks
    Pair 13 7.5 inch background squares with 13 7.5 inch light blue squares and use the two at a time HST method to make 26 HSTs
    Press all HSTs open
    Pair all HSTS right sides together with opposite fabrics facing each other and use the two at a time HST method to make 26 hourglass blocks
    Press all hourglass blocks open
    Trim 25 hourglass blocks to 6.5 inches square
    Make 24 nine patch blocks
    arrange all of your 2.5 inch squares into 24 nine patch blocks
    your darkest color fabric goes in the 4 corners with the background color forming a plus sign and the center square is your medium color fabric
    Make Quilt Top
    arrange blocks in a 7x7 layout, begin with an hourglass block and follow video instructions to alternate every block and row
    Make Quilt Back
    If using 42 inch wide fabric cut 1 piece 50 inches by WOF and 2 pieces 8.5 inches by WOF
    sew the 8.5 inch pieces end to end and trim to 8.5 x 50 inches and sew to the larger piece, finished backing should measure 50 x 50 inches
    Quilt as desired
    Bind quilt
